This wireless camera kit is ideal for truck owners who need a reliable, no-fuss rearview solution without running long cables from the tail to the cab. It provides a clear, stable image to enhance safety during reversing and hitching.

The core feature is its 2.4GHz wireless transmission. It sends a video signal from the rear camera to the monitor up to 100 feet away. This eliminates the complex and time-consuming process of routing a video cable through the vehicle’s frame. For a truck driver, this means a much faster and cleaner installation. The IP69K waterproof rating on the camera is another key feature. It ensures the system keeps working in heavy rain, snow, or when spraying down the truck bed, which is common in commercial use.

The system is built for durability with a metal camera housing and a simple, plug-and-play setup. While the monitor is basic, it delivers a consistent picture crucial for judging distance to obstacles or aligning a fifth-wheel. For a universal wireless backup camera that balances ease of installation with all-weather performance, the eRapta ERT01 is a solid, practical choice.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Are eRapta backup cameras compatible with all truck models?

A1: Yes, eRapta systems are generally universal. They connect to your reverse light circuit for power and video activation, making them compatible with most trucks, from light-duty pickups to heavy-duty rigs. The included hardware typically suits standard license plate mounts.

Q2: How difficult is the self-installation process?

A2: Most users with basic mechanical skill can complete the installation in 1-2 hours. It involves routing a cable from the rear camera to the front monitor, connecting to the reverse light wire for automatic activation, and securing the components. Detailed instructions are provided.

Q3: Can I leave the monitor on to use as a rear-view camera while driving?

A3: While the camera is designed to activate with reverse gear, many eRapta monitors have a manual power-on function. This allows you to use it as a casual rear-view aid, but it should not replace your primary mirrors.

Q4: Is the night vision feature effective?

A4: The infrared LEDs on eRapta cameras provide a clear, illuminated black-and-white image in low-light conditions. It effectively outlines obstacles and people directly behind the truck, though range and clarity decrease in complete darkness compared to daytime.

Q5: What should I do if the screen shows static or “No Signal”?

A5: First, check all power connections at the camera and monitor. For wireless models, ensure the transmitter and receiver are securely powered and that there’s no major metal obstruction. For wired models, inspect the video cable for pinches or cuts.
